色婷婷狠狠18禁久久YY,CHINESE性内射高清国产,国产女人18毛片水真多1,国产AV在线观看

mysql200并發(fā)怎么優(yōu)化?

MySQL是目前最受歡迎的關(guān)系型數(shù)據(jù)庫(kù)之一,但是在高并發(fā)的情況下,MySQL可能會(huì)遇到性能問(wèn)題。在本文中,我們將介紹如何優(yōu)化MySQL200并發(fā),以提高其性能和可靠性。

一、數(shù)據(jù)庫(kù)優(yōu)化

1. 確保正確的索引

索引是提高M(jìn)ySQL性能的關(guān)鍵。在高并發(fā)情況下,正確的索引可以大大提高查詢速度。建議使用覆蓋索引,盡量避免使用全表掃描。

2. 優(yōu)化查詢語(yǔ)句

查詢語(yǔ)句的優(yōu)化可以大大提高M(jìn)ySQL的性能。建議使用合適的查詢語(yǔ)句,避免使用子查詢和聯(lián)合查詢。可以使用EXPLAIN命令來(lái)分析查詢語(yǔ)句是否有優(yōu)化空間。

3. 優(yōu)化表結(jié)構(gòu)

表結(jié)構(gòu)的優(yōu)化可以提高M(jìn)ySQL的性能。建議使用合適的數(shù)據(jù)類型,避免使用TEXT和BLOB類型。可以使用分區(qū)表和水平拆分來(lái)提高查詢速度。

二、服務(wù)器優(yōu)化

1. 增加內(nèi)存

在高并發(fā)情況下,內(nèi)存是提高M(jìn)ySQL性能的關(guān)鍵。建議增加服務(wù)器的內(nèi)存,以提高M(jìn)ySQL的緩存效率。可以調(diào)整MySQL的緩存參數(shù),以適應(yīng)服務(wù)器的內(nèi)存大小。

2. 優(yōu)化CPU

CPU是提高M(jìn)ySQL性能的關(guān)鍵。建議使用多核CPU,并調(diào)整MySQL的線程數(shù),以充分利用CPU資源。

3. 優(yōu)化磁盤

磁盤也是提高M(jìn)ySQL性能的關(guān)鍵。建議使用RAID來(lái)提高磁盤讀寫速度。可以使用SSD硬盤來(lái)提高磁盤讀寫速度。

三、其他優(yōu)化

1. 使用緩存

cached和Redis來(lái)緩存查詢結(jié)果和熱點(diǎn)數(shù)據(jù),以提高查詢速度。

2. 使用分布式架構(gòu)

在高并發(fā)情況下,分布式架構(gòu)可以提高M(jìn)ySQL的性能和可靠性。可以使用分布式數(shù)據(jù)庫(kù),如MySQL Cluster和Galera Cluster,來(lái)提高M(jìn)ySQL的性能和可靠性。

3. 定期優(yōu)化

定期優(yōu)化可以保持MySQL的性能和可靠性。建議定期清理無(wú)用數(shù)據(jù),壓縮表空間,以及優(yōu)化索引和查詢語(yǔ)句。

MySQL是一款強(qiáng)大的關(guān)系型數(shù)據(jù)庫(kù),但在高并發(fā)情況下,需要進(jìn)行優(yōu)化以提高性能和可靠性。本文介紹了如何優(yōu)化MySQL200并發(fā),包括數(shù)據(jù)庫(kù)優(yōu)化、服務(wù)器優(yōu)化和其他優(yōu)化。通過(guò)這些優(yōu)化,可以提高M(jìn)ySQL的性能和可靠性,滿足高并發(fā)場(chǎng)景的需求。